Vanity Fair got their hands on an interesting batch of images that offer the first look at the upcoming Netflix release THE OLD GUARD, which stars Charlize Theron as a 6000 year old warrior. A handful of those images have been shared here in this article. 

Here's the background on Theron's character: 

Her name is Andromache of Scythia. She was born thousands of years ago, and has died hundreds of times — only to resurrect and fight again and again and again. She hides from the world but fearlessly confronts its darker corners, weaving in and out of history and mythology. In 425 B.C., she inspired the hero from one of Euripides’s only surviving plays; in the 1860s she was a soldier for the Union in the Civil War, and she is still picking up the club, the sword, the gun for every good fight she can find. Her name literally means “man-fighter” or “battler of men.” But she goes by “Andy” now.

Directed by Gina Prince-Bythewood from a screenplay by Greg Rucka, who also created (with artist Leandro Fernandez) the graphic novel series the film is based on, THE OLD GUARD finds 

Andromache in the present day. She’s still living off the grid and leading a tactical vigilante team of other immortals that takes out human traffickers, terrorists, and anyone else who preys on the vulnerable and the innocent. But she’s tired. Doubtful. Somewhat hopeless. After all these centuries, the world just seems to be becoming more cruel and agonizing, not less so.

Andy is reenergized when a new immortal, KiKi Layne as U.S. Marine Nile Freeman, turns up. Nile finds out she's immortal after being killed in action during a mission in the Middle East.

Also on Andy's team of vigilantes are Matthias Schoenaerts as a French soldier who fought alongside Napoleon, and Luca Marinelli and Marwan Kenzari as former enemies who fought against each other in the Crusades and are now in a relationship. Chiwetel Ejiofor is in the cast as a CIA operative who has figured out the immortals' identities, and Harry Melling as a pharma executive who wants to capture the immortals and experiment on them.

Although this is a comic book adaptation with superhuman characters, Prince-Bythewood said she wanted to keep the film grounded in reality, drawing inspiration from Kathryn Bigelow's ZERO DARK THIRTY and Tony Scott's MAN ON FIRE.

I never wanted any moment to take an audience out of the fact that these could be real people. This is somebody that can get stabbed and walk away, but it’s going to hurt."
